Buses Automatic Passenger Counting systems in buses enable transit operators to track real-time passenger flow, optimize routes, and enhance scheduling efficiency. The increasing adoption of smart transportation solutions in urban areas drives demand for APC technology in buses. With governments focusing on intelligent transit solutions, the market for APC in buses is expected to grow substantially.
Trains APC systems in trains provide precise occupancy data, which is critical for ensuring passenger comfort and efficient train scheduling. These systems aid railway operators in managing peak-hour congestion and improving service reliability. The integration of AI-driven analytics and IoT technologies is further enhancing the capabilities of APC in railway networks.
Ferryboats In ferry operations, APC technology helps in tracking passenger numbers, complying with safety regulations, and optimizing boarding processes. As ferry networks expand, particularly in coastal cities and island nations, the demand for advanced passenger counting solutions is expected to rise.

The APC market is categorized based on sensing technologies, which offer varying levels of accuracy, cost-effectiveness, and implementation complexity.
Infrared Infrared-based passenger counting systems use heat sensors to detect human presence and movement. These systems are cost-effective and widely used in buses and trains. However, they may have limitations in distinguishing multiple passengers closely positioned together.
Stereoscopic Vision Stereoscopic vision technology uses 3D imaging to accurately count passengers, even in crowded conditions. This technology is gaining popularity due to its high accuracy and ability to differentiate between adults, children, and objects.
Time-of-Flight (ToF) Time-of-Flight sensors use light pulses to detect passenger movement and provide precise real-time data. These systems are particularly effective in high-traffic environments and are being increasingly adopted in modern transit systems.
